Как проверить, что данные запроса sql execute являются нулевыми в выражении приложения логики? - PullRequest
0 голосов
/ 04 июля 2019

В приложении логики после выполнения SQL_Exceute_Query Я получил результат, как показано ниже -

{
  "OutputParameters": {},
  "ResultSets": {}
}

Как я могу проверить, ResultSets нет данных, использующих выражение?

Я пробовал как body('Exceute_a_sql_query')?['ResultSets'] is not equal to '{}' в condition connector, но у меня не работает.

Если body('Exceute_a_sql_query')?['ResultSets'] having data go to if otherwise go to else

1 Ответ

3 голосов
/ 04 июля 2019

Я пробовал оба is equal to и is not equal to, они оба работают. Однако вы не можете определить его с помощью конструктора, вы должны определить его с помощью Code view, иначе он не примет {} в качестве значения.

enter image description here

Я определяю переменную со значением ResultSets.

enter image description here

Надеюсь, это поможет вам.

...